Hamas Political Bureau Chief Khaled Meshaal has warned that the
Israeli regime will adopt more ‘extremist’ policies following the March
election, which saw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u win another term
in office.
There would be “more extremism” as Netanyahu’s Likud party and its
right-wing allies have remained in power in the occupied Palestinian
territories, Meshaal stated in an interview with the state-funded BBC.
The Hamas political leader further blamed Israel’s “extremist
leadership” for the failure of the so-called peace process, saying that
Tel Aviv’s policies has killed “every opportunity of a political
solution for the Palestinian cause.”
Elsewhere in his remarks, he condemned Takfiri terrorist groups such
as the al-Nusra Front and ISIL for perpetrating acts of violence in the
name of the holy religion of Islam.
Meshaal also rejected the claims that Hamas flares up violence in the
occupied territories and the besieged Gaza strip, stressing that “as
long as there is occupation, aggression, war and killing,” the
Palestinian resistance will continue.

Netanyahu had vowed prior to his re-election that the Palestinians
would not get an independent state in the occupied West Bank, East
al-Quds (Jerusalem) and Gaza if he secured a new term.
Rights groups and the international community have severely
criticized Netanyahu for his electoral promise to press ahead with
settlement construction in East al-Quds (Jerusalem).
More than half a million Israelis live in over 120 illegal
settlements built since Israel’s occupation of the West Bank including
East al-Quds in 1967.
Much of the international community regards the settlements as
illegal because the territories were captured by Israel in the 1967 war
and are hence subject to the Geneva Conventions, which forbid
construction on occupied land.
